Okay, it’s possible that this song by Rankin Taxi and the Dub Ainu band is just a teeny bit reductive about nuclear power. It’s also possible that it is SUPER AWESOME. Somehow it is simultaneously serious, funny, angry, stylish, and catchy. As. Hell.
Seriously, is all the good protest music dubstep now, and nobody told me? I’ve been lamenting the death of punk, and it turns out I should have just been listening to dance music.
(Via Noah Raford on Twitter)